Program Structure and Curriculum
Eligibility:
- B.A./B.Sc. with Geography with 45% marks in aggregate or any other examination recognized by Kurukshetra University as equivalent thereto.
Duration: 2 years (4 semesters)
Credits: 92 Credits
Assessment: Internal: 30%, External: 70%
Semester-wise Curriculum Table
Semester 1
| Subject Code | Subject Name | Subject Type | Credits | Key Topics |
|---|---|---|---|---|
| GEG-101 | Geotectonics and Geomorphology | Core | 4 | Earth''''s Interior and Structure, Continental Drift and Plate Tectonics, Rocks, Minerals and Denudation, Fluvial and Glacial Processes, Aeolian and Coastal Processes |
| GEG-102 | Climatology and Oceanography | Core | 4 | Atmospheric Composition and Structure, Insolation and Heat Budget, Atmospheric Circulation and Weather, Koppen''''s Climatic Classification, Ocean Relief, Currents and Marine Resources |
| GEG-103 | Economic Geography | Core | 4 | Economic Activities and Sectors, Theories of Industrial Location, Agriculture, Mining and Manufacturing, Globalization and World Trade, Resource Management and Sustainable Development |
| GEG-104 | Population and Settlement Geography | Core | 4 | Population Distribution and Growth, Demographic Transition Theories, Migration and Population Problems, Rural and Urban Settlements, Urbanization and Central Place Theory |
| GEG-105 | Practical I: Cartography (Thematic Maps, Projections and Surveying) | Lab | 3 | Scales and Map Reading, Thematic Mapping Techniques, Map Projections, Prismatic Compass Surveying, Dumpy Level Surveying |
| GEG-106 | Practical II: Statistical Methods | Lab | 3 | Data Classification and Tabulation, Measures of Central Tendency, Measures of Dispersion, Probability and Sampling, Correlation and Regression Analysis |
Semester 2
| Subject Code | Subject Name | Subject Type | Credits | Key Topics |
|---|---|---|---|---|
| GEG-201 | Environmental Geography | Core | 4 | Components of Environment and Ecosystems, Environmental Degradation and Pollution, Climate Change and Global Warming, Environmental Impact Assessment, Sustainable Development and Conservation |
| GEG-202 | Regional Planning and Development | Core | 4 | Concepts of Region and Regionalization, Theories of Regional Development, Regional Imbalances in India, Multi-Level Planning, Sustainable Regional Development |
| GEG-203 | Agricultural Geography | Core | 4 | Origin and Evolution of Agriculture, Agricultural Regions of the World, Theories of Agricultural Location, Green Revolution and its Impact, Food Security and Agricultural Policies |
| GEG-204 | Social and Cultural Geography | Core | 4 | Culture, Cultural Hearths and Diffusion, Religious and Linguistic Geography, Race and Ethnicity, Social Well-being and Quality of Life, Geography of Health and Disease |
| GEG-205 | Practical III: Remote Sensing | Lab | 3 | Principles of Remote Sensing, Electromagnetic Radiation and Spectrum, Satellite Orbits and Sensors, Image Interpretation Techniques, Digital Image Processing Fundamentals |
| GEG-206 | Practical IV: Geographic Information System (GIS) | Lab | 3 | Components and Function of GIS, Spatial Data Models (Raster and Vector), Data Input, Editing and Management, Spatial Analysis Techniques, Network and Terrain Analysis |
Semester 3
| Subject Code | Subject Name | Subject Type | Credits | Key Topics |
|---|---|---|---|---|
| GEG-301 | Evolution of Geographical Thought | Core | 4 | Ancient and Medieval Geographical Knowledge, German, French and British Schools of Geography, Determinism, Possibilism and Neo-Determinism, Quantitative Revolution and Behaviouralism, Radical, Humanistic and Postmodern Geography |
| GEG-302 | Disaster Management | Core | 4 | Concept of Hazard, Vulnerability and Disaster, Types of Natural and Anthropogenic Disasters, Disaster Mitigation and Preparedness, Disaster Response and Recovery, Role of GIS and Remote Sensing in Disaster Management |
| GEG-303 | Hydrology and Water Resource Management | Core | 4 | Hydrological Cycle and its Components, Precipitation, Evaporation and Runoff, Groundwater Hydrology, Water Quality and Pollution, Integrated Water Resource Management |
| GEG-304 | Urban Geography | Core | 4 | Origin and Evolution of Towns, Urbanization Process and Trends, Theories of Urban Structure and Growth, Urban Functions and Hierarchy, Urban Problems and Planning Strategies |
| GEG-305 | Practical V: Field Work and Survey Techniques | Lab | 3 | Importance of Field Work in Geography, Types of Field Surveys, Questionnaire Design and Data Collection, Report Writing and Presentation, Application of GPS in Field Survey |
| GEG-306 | Practical VI: Applications of Remote Sensing and GIS | Lab | 3 | RS & GIS in Land Use/Land Cover Mapping, RS & GIS in Water Resource Management, RS & GIS in Urban Planning, RS & GIS in Agriculture and Forestry, RS & GIS in Disaster Management |
Semester 4
| Subject Code | Subject Name | Subject Type | Credits | Key Topics |
|---|---|---|---|---|
| GEG-401 | Geography of India | Core | 4 | Physiographic Divisions of India, Climate, Soils and Natural Vegetation, Water Resources and Agriculture, Population Distribution and Growth, Regional Disparities and Planning |
| GEG-402 | Research Methodology | Core | 4 | Concept and Types of Research, Research Design and Hypothesis Formulation, Data Collection Methods and Sampling, Statistical Analysis of Data, Report Writing and Ethical Considerations |
| GEG-403 | Dissertation / Project Report | Project | 6 | Problem Identification and Literature Review, Methodology and Data Analysis, Chapterization and Report Writing, Presentation of Research Findings, Independent Research Project |
| GEG-404 | Viva-Voce | Other | 4 | Comprehensive Knowledge of Geography, Defense of Dissertation/Project Report, Oral Examination of Subject Knowledge |
| GEG-405 | Social and Cultural Geography of India | Elective | 4 | Regional Cultural Diversities in India, Tribal Population and their Problems, Religious Demography and Conflicts, Linguistic Regions and Issues, Social Well-being and Development Issues |
| GEG-406 | Political Geography | Elective | 4 | Evolution of Political Geography, State, Nation and Nation-State, Frontiers, Boundaries and Geopolitics, Electoral Geography and Voting Patterns, International Relations and Global Issues |
| GEG-407 | Bio-Geography | Elective | 4 | Biogeographical Regions of the World, Ecosystems and Biodiversity, Conservation of Flora and Fauna, Ecological Succession and Biogeochemical Cycles, Plant and Animal Adaptation |
| GEG-408 | Geography of Tourism | Elective | 4 | Concepts and Types of Tourism, Tourist Resources and Attractions, Impacts of Tourism (Economic, Social, Environmental), Sustainable Tourism Development, Tourism Planning and Management |
